Linux系统下高效部署指南
linux下部署

首页 2024-12-14 16:11:23



Linux下部署:高效、稳定与可扩展性的不二之选 在当今的数字化时代,服务器操作系统的选择对于企业级应用部署而言至关重要

    在众多操作系统中,Linux凭借其开源、高效、稳定以及高度的可扩展性,成为了众多企业和开发者的首选

    本文将深入探讨在Linux下部署的优势、步骤以及实践中的最佳实践,旨在帮助读者理解为何Linux是部署应用的理想平台

     一、Linux部署的核心优势 1. 开源与低成本 Linux作为最流行的开源操作系统之一,其源代码公开透明,意味着用户可以自由获取、修改和分发

    这一特性极大地降低了企业的软件成本,不仅避免了高昂的授权费用,还促进了社区驱动的持续优化和安全性增强

    此外,丰富的开源软件和工具链进一步降低了开发和运维的门槛

     2. 高效性能 Linux内核经过多年优化,以其高效处理能力和低资源占用著称

    无论是处理大量并发请求、执行复杂计算任务,还是在资源受限的环境中运行,Linux都能提供出色的性能表现

    这种高效性对于需要高性能计算、大数据分析或实时处理的应用尤为关键

     3. 卓越稳定性 稳定性和可靠性是Linux操作系统的另一大亮点

    得益于其强大的内存管理和错误处理机制,Linux系统能够长时间稳定运行,减少宕机时间和维护成本

    这对于需要24小时不间断服务的企业应用来说至关重要

     4. 高度安全性 Linux以其强大的安全性闻名于世

    得益于开源社区的积极维护,Linux系统能够迅速响应安全漏洞并发布补丁

    同时,Linux提供多种安全机制,如SELinux、AppArmor等,帮助企业构建更安全的运行环境

     5. 广泛的硬件支持 Linux支持几乎所有类型的硬件平台,从高性能服务器到嵌入式设备,都能找到适合的Linux发行版

    这种广泛的硬件兼容性使得Linux成为跨平台部署的理想选择

     6. 强大的社区支持 Linux拥有庞大的用户和开发者社区,这意味着在遇到问题时,可以迅速获得来自全球的帮助和支持

    社区中丰富的文档、教程和论坛资源,极大地简化了学习和解决问题的过程

     二、Linux下部署的基本步骤 1. 选择合适的Linux发行版 Linux发行版众多,如Ubuntu、CentOS、Debian等,每种发行版都有其特点和适用场景

    选择时,需考虑应用需求、团队熟悉度、社区支持和软件兼容性等因素

     2. 安装Linux系统 根据所选发行版,下载IS